Volkswagen Golf Owners Manual: Using a child seat on the front passenger seat

First read and observe the introductory information and safety warnings

Not all countries allow you to transport children on the front passenger seat. Not every child seat is suitable for use on the front passenger seat. Volkswagen dealerships keep an up-to-date list of all authorised child seats. Only use child seats that have been authorised for your vehicle.

The active front airbag on the front passenger side presents a major danger to a child. Transporting a child in a rear-facing child seat on the front passenger seat can pose a danger to the child's life.

If a rear-facing child seat is secured to the front passenger seat, an inflating front passenger front airbag can strike it with such force that critical or fatal injuries may occur  . Therefore, never use a rear-facing child seat on the front passenger seat when the front passenger front airbag is activated.

Only use a rear-facing child seat on the front passenger seat when you have ascertained that the front passenger front airbag has been switched off. This is confirmed when the yellow indicator lamp in the dash panel PASSENGER AIR BAG lights up   . If the front passenger front airbag cannot be switched off and stays active, do not transport any children on the front passenger seat  .

What to be aware of when using a child seat on the front passenger seat:

Suitable child seats

The child seat must be specially authorised by the manufacturer for use on the front passenger seat in vehicles with front and side airbags.

Universal child seats in groups 0, 0+, 1, 2, or 3, as specified in ECE-R 44, can be fitted to the front passenger seat.

DANGER

If a child seat is secured to the front passenger seat, the risk to the child of sustaining critical or fatal injuries in the event of an accident increases. Never use a rear-facing child seat on the front passenger seat if the front passenger front airbag is enabled. The child could suffer fatal injuries when the front airbag is activated as the child seat will be hit by the airbag with full force and thrown against the seat backrest.
